To me it matters depending on exactly who had it before.
For example, I have a couple stamps from FDRs collection - he was a collector, involved in choosing the designs for stamps while president, but somewhat oddly, didn't have many really valuable items.
I have a few other things from great collections, and they can be fun. Most big collections had a load of cheap things alongside the nicer ones.
